I fixed the problem by replacing the connector on top of alt. The small wire was broke
inside insulator right at the connector.

I had the same problem with my 99 250 SD diesel and after going through three alternators, I found a broken wire in the harness over the left rocker cover. If you can't find the problem, this might be a place to start.
